WebFeb 28, 2024 · All you need to do is: Create the Stored Procedure. Grant EXECUTE on the Stored Procedure to the User (s) and/or Role (s) that should be able to perform the TRUNCATE. Create a Certificate. Create a User from the Certificate. WebJul 30, 2024 · In SQL Server or Azure SQL Database Managed Instance, you can grant ALTER on a Database in 2 ways: Besides the Database Permission “ALTER”, there is also a Server Permission “ALTER ANY DATABASE”.
